BBC Two has acquired Trust, the ten-part series star-packed drama from the Academy Award-winning ‘Slumdog Millionaire’ team of Danny Boyle, Simon Beaufoy and Christian Colson, about the kidnapping of John Paul Getty III, heir to the Getty oil fortune.

Trust stars Donald Sutherland (‘The Hunger Games’) as J. Paul Getty Senior, the oil tycoon and art collector at the head of the Getty family, alongside a stellar cast that includes Hilary Swank (‘Million Dollar Baby’), Brendan Fraser (‘The Mummy’), Harris Dickinson (‘Beach Rats’), Anna Chancellor (‘Ordeal By Innocence’), Charlotte Riley (‘Peaky Blinders’), Amanda Drew (‘Broadchurch’) and Sophie Winkleman (‘Peep Show’).

“I am tremendously excited that Trust is coming to BBC Two,” commented Patrick Holland, Controller of BBC Two. “The series has the unique scale, singular vision and extraordinary swagger that only Danny Boyle, Simon Beaufoy and Christian Colson can bring.”

Trust opens in 1973 with the kidnapping of John Paul Getty III (Dickinson), heir to the Getty fortune, in Rome. His captors bank on a multi-million dollar ransom, but back in England Paul’s wealthy grandfather (Sutherland) refuses to pay up. With Paul’s father (Michael Esper) lost in a drug-induced daze, it is left to Paul’s mother – the penniless Gail Getty (Swank) – to negotiate with both the increasingly desperate kidnappers and her stubborn former father-in-law to save her son.

Trust examines the corrosive power of money and explores the complexities at the heart of every family, rich or poor.

“Trust is bold storytelling, made with verve, style and ambition,” adds Sue Deeks, Head of BBC Programme Acquisition. “The Getty family have captured the public’s imagination like few others, and there is no better team to reimagine their story for television than the award-winning trio of Danny Boyle, Simon Beaufoy and Christian Colson. We’re very excited to bring this compelling new series to BBC Two.”

Those of you that are regular readers of the site might remember ‘Trust’ was originally picked up by Sky Atlantic. However, for reasons which are not exactly clear, they came to an agreement with Twentieth Century Fox Television Distribution not to air the show in the UK and Germany, and BBC Two swooped it on the rights.

Trust will premiere in the UK exclusively on BBC Two later in 2018. The series is created by Simon Beaufoy and executive produced by Danny Boyle, Beaufoy and Christian Colson, with Boyle directing the first three episodes.
